I'm glad you found the themes interesting! Let's explore a possible gameplay scenario for the "Quantum Uncertainty" theme.
Title: Quantum Echoes
Gameplay Overview:
In "Quantum Echoes," the player takes on the role of a scientist who has gained the power to manipulate quantum states, thanks to an experiment gone awry. The game features a 2D puzzle-platformer structure, where the player must navigate through levels while using their newfound quantum abilities to alter the environment and overcome challenges.
Core Mechanic: Quantum State Manipulation
The player can shift between multiple parallel realities within the game, each representing a different probability. This ability allows the player to access different versions of objects, platforms, or environmental elements, as well as avoid or neutralize threats.
For example, a platform might exist in one quantum state, while it is missing in another. The player can use their ability to change the state and create a path through the level. Alternatively, they might encounter a locked door in one state, and switch to another state where the door is open.
As the game progresses, the player's quantum abilities become more advanced, enabling them to manipulate multiple quantum states at once or even create temporary "quantum echoes" that combine elements from various states.
Puzzles and Challenges:
Levels are designed with intricate puzzles that require the player to strategically manipulate quantum states to progress. Puzzles may involve combining elements from different states, timing state changes, or even dealing with quantum entanglements that link the behavior of objects across states.
Enemies and Hazards:
Players will encounter enemies and hazards that also exist in multiple quantum states or have quantum abilities themselves. For instance, an enemy could be invulnerable in one state, but vulnerable in another. Hazards may shift between states, forcing the player to react quickly and make use of their quantum powers.
Narrative and Setting:
The game's story unfolds as the scientist explores the consequences of their newfound powers, seeks a way to reverse the experiment's effects, and ultimately unravels the mysteries of the quantum world. The setting could blend elements of futuristic technology, alternate dimensions, and a touch of cosmic intrigue.

To implement the core mechanics of the "Quantum Uncertainty" theme in Unity, you'll need to focus on creating a system that can manage parallel realities and handle interactions between them. Here's a high-level breakdown of how to approach this:
Create Parallel Realities:
Design multiple versions of the game world representing different quantum states. This can be achieved by using multiple layers or separate scenes for each state. Each layer or scene contains objects, platforms, and environmental elements specific to its corresponding quantum state.
Manage Quantum States:
Create a QuantumStateManager script that will be responsible for keeping track of the active quantum state and managing transitions between states. It should store references to each state (layer or scene) and facilitate communication between them.
Transition Between States:
Develop a mechanic that allows the player to switch between quantum states. This could be a button press or an in-game action. When triggered, the QuantumStateManager should activate the selected state (layer or scene), while deactivating the others. This may involve enabling/disabling GameObjects or loading/unloading scenes asynchronously.
Quantum Interactions:
Design a system that manages interactions between objects and entities across quantum states. For example, an object in one state might influence the behavior of an object in another state (quantum entanglement). Create scripts and components that can detect and react to such interactions, while communicating with the QuantumStateManager.
Character Controller:
Modify the player character's controller script to be aware of the current quantum state and respond accordingly. This includes interacting with objects and platforms, as well as reacting to enemies and hazards unique to each state.
Advanced Quantum Abilities:
As the game progresses, you may want to introduce more advanced quantum abilities, such as manipulating multiple states at once or creating temporary "quantum echoes." These mechanics will require further modification to the QuantumStateManager, as well as additional scripts and components for managing these abilities.
Polish and Visual Feedback:
To enhance the player experience, add visual effects and audio cues that help indicate the current quantum state and state transitions. This could include screen filters, particle effects, or sound effects to create a distinct atmosphere for each state.
Implementing these core mechanics in Unity may require a deep understanding of the engine's capabilities, as well as solid programming skills to ensure a smooth gameplay experience. Once the mechanics are in place, you can focus on designing levels and puzzles that leverage the unique properties of the quantum world.
